A superb, detached, 1930s property with beautiful, well-proportioned accommodation extending to 2,419 sq ft, in this charming village location, just 3 miles from Cambridge.
Cambridge 3 miles, Waterbeach 1 mile (Liverpool Street and King's Cross lines), A14 2 miles, M11 (junction 14) 3.3 miles, Cambridge North railway station 3 miles (distances and approximate).
91 Waterbeach Road is a 1930s, detached property constructed with brick elevations under a tiled roof. The property has been the subject of a comprehensive programme of extension and improvements in recent years including the addition of a kitchen/dining room and a substantial and elegant conservatory, which is a particularly fine feature of the property. The beautifully presented accommodation is light and airy, and exudes a warm and welcoming ambience throughout.
Landbeach is a picturesque village with 2 churches, village hall and a large recreation ground with children's play area, tennis court and meadow with pond and seating area. A further range of facilities including playgroups and primary schools, are available in the nearby villages of Milton and Waterbeach, both within about 1.5 miles. Secondary school education is available at nearby Cottenham Village College.
For the commuter, the nearby A10 provides access to the A14, which in turn links with the A1 to the north and the M11 to the south. Waterbeach Railway Station and Cambridge North Railway Station provides services to London's King's Cross and Liverpool Street in approximately 58 and 85 minutes respectively.
The University City of Cambridge lies just 3 miles to the south and provides an excellent range of shopping, educational and cultural facilities. It is also an important centre of the 'high tech' and research and development industry with the world renowned Cambridge Scient Park, situated just to the south of the A14.
